Web2 mrt. 2024 · Musical differences: The orchestra: operas tend to have bigger and more complex orchestras The singers: operas tend to be focussed around soloist, while masses tend to be centered around choirs with a small amount of … Weboratorio, a large-scale musical composition on a sacred or semisacred subject, for solo voices, chorus, and orchestra. An oratorio’s text is usually based on scripture, and the narration necessary to move from scene to scene is supplied by recitatives sung by various voices to prepare the way for airs and choruses. Web28 mrt. 2024 · The cantata can be described as being a cross between an opera and an oratorio. The subject matter is usually religious such as the Ode to St Cecilia’s Day by Handel or Purcell’s Anthems (which can be classified as cantatas), but there are instances when cantatas may treat a secular subject.
